38 Chiltern Rise

    38, CHILTERN RISE, LUTON, LU1 5HF

    This terraced freehold property on Chiltern Rise last sold in May 2018 for £235,000. Based on price growth in the LU1 district since then, its estimated current value is £297,157 — placing it in the 49th percentile nationally and the 57th percentile within LU1. The property covers 86 m² (926 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£3,455 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— LU1

    LU1 covers Luton town centre and its immediate surroundings in Bedfordshire, positioned north of London on the main transport corridor. It is a densely populated urban area with a diverse, younger demographic and a strong private rental market.
